Tottenham Hale station caters to a variety of passenger needs with its comprehensive facilities.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 06:10 to 19:10, with slightly adjusted weekend hours from 08:10 to 19:10. For those who prefer self-service, there are ticket machines, including accessible ones, throughout the station. If you've bought your tickets online, they can easily be collected at these machines, ensuring a seamless start to your journey.
Accessibility is an essential consideration at Tottenham Hale, offering step-free access across the station. There are no stairs required to reach all platforms, adhering to the ORR classification of a Category A station. Even accessible toilets, a seating area, and waiting rooms are available to ensure comfort for all passengers. For extra peace of mind, the station is equipped with CCTV for enhanced security.
One of the unique aspects of Tottenham Hale is its exceptional connectivity. Although not serviced by rail replacement transport, the station provides alternatives like London Underground's Victoria Line services directly accessible from here. Buses operated by Transport for London stop just outside the station front, and taxis are readily available around the clock. Additionally, those with flights to catch can enjoy direct train services to Stansted Airport via the Stansted Express, offering a straightforward route to your international adventures.

Hightown station is equipped with a ticket office that operates from the early morning hours of 05:47 until midnight, making it convenient for both early risers and night owls. Although ticket machines are not available, tickets purchased online can be easily collected from the ticket office. Additionally, for those using smartcards, Hightown station offers smartcard issuance as well as validators.
For travelers needing extra assistance, the station provides support through both the help point and ticket office. You'll have access to departure and arrival screens, along with announcements to keep you informed of any updates. Although the station lacks luggage storage and accessible toilets, you'll find helpful staff available during the ticket office's operating hours. For lost property inquiries, note that services are available Monday through Friday in the early hours and late afternoons.
Accessibility is a priority at Hightown. Despite having step-free access, platforms are connected by a stepped footbridge. If you require step-free routes, options are available via public roads. For cycling enthusiasts, secure bicycle storage with 44 spaces and CCTV protection is available. Although there are no hire facilities, these secure spaces can be quite handy.
Moving beyond the station is easy, with several transport links accessible to travelers. While there isn't a taxi rank available, various bus services extend your travel options. In case of a rail replacement, head to Kerslake Way in Hightown, Liverpool. For air travelers,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is the nearest option with easy transportation via the 86A or 80A bus routes. In-depth travel information can be accessed through Merseytravel or Traveline.
